About this course

This course offers practical tools and insights to help you create safer, more supportive learning environments. You’ll learn how trauma can impact behaviour, relationships, and learning—and how small, intentional shifts in your approach can make a big difference.  

We’ll explore real-world strategies for co-regulation, predictability, and connection that you can apply immediately, regardless of your role or setting. Whether you're just beginning or refining your trauma-informed practice, this session will deepen your understanding and support your wellbeing as an educator. 

You will:

  • Understand how trauma can impact learning, behaviour, and relationships in the classroom 
  • Identify key trauma-informed strategies to support safety, connection, and regulation 
  • Recognise the importance of educator wellbeing in creating trauma-informed environments

About the presenter

Megan Corcoran founded The Wagtail Institute to help all children to have a safe and magical childhood with support from adults who believe in their future. Using her real-world knowledge from nearly 20 years as an educator, Megan now partners with schools and youth services to bring this vision to life.
